The event, organized by the Societat Catalana de Química, started with a short introduction by Carles Bo, the president of the SCQ, and then was followed by the two presentations of our researchers:
- «Àtoms, molècules… i materials» by Susagna Ricart Miró - Susagna, from the SUMAN group, explained which were the building blocks of the materials that we create at ICMAB: the atoms! And from there, she explained many of the functional advanced materials that we design and prepare, and some of their applications, such as carbon nanotubes for drug delivery, for example.
- «Kit de materials a l’aula (ICMAB)» by Arántzazu González Campo - Arántzazu,from the FunNanoSurf group, explained the activity "Un investigador a la teva aula", in which volunteer researchers from ICMAB go to secondary school classes to explain how they became a scientist, and show some of the materials that we have here in our "materials kit", such as gold nanoparticles, silica gel or superconducting tapes.
After the two talks, which were very well received by the audience, the two speakers answered some of the questions of the audience. Some of the teachers were very interested in the activity explained by Arántzazu. Moreover, the two researchers encouraged the students to study Chemistry, which is very much needed in Materials Science research. "Chemistry is everything" concluded Susagna.
During the coffee break, we could see the posters of some of the Research Projects exposed, and after the pause, Fina Guitart, president of the 12th Edition of the Research Projects Awards, announced the centers which will host some of the students internships. ICMAB will host three students during July 2018. The event concluded with the presentation of the two first prizes of the Research Projects: one about the antibiotic effect of garlic, and the other one about air pollution and climate change.
